Understanding Wagering Requirements for My Empire Casino Bonus
One of the most critical aspects of any casino bonus, including those at My Empire Casino, is the wagering requirement. This is the number of times you must bet the bonus amount (and sometimes your deposit amount) before you can withdraw any winnings derived from it. For example, a 30x wagering requirement on a $100 bonus means you need to wager $3,000 before cashing out. Failing to understand these requirements can lead to frustration, as winnings might appear locked until the conditions are met.
- Always check the wagering requirement percentage for both bonus funds and free spins winnings.
- Note any game restrictions that apply to wagering; some games may contribute less or not at all towards meeting the requirement.
- Be aware of time limits imposed on meeting wagering requirements; you typically have a set period to fulfill them.
- Understand the maximum bet allowed while playing with bonus funds, as exceeding this can void your bonus and winnings.

Essential Terms and Conditions of My Empire Casino Bonus
Beyond wagering requirements, a host of other terms and conditions govern how you can use your My Empire Casino bonus and what you need to do to convert bonus funds into withdrawable cash. These can include minimum deposit amounts to qualify for a bonus, maximum withdrawal limits from bonus winnings, and restrictions on which games you can play. For instance, some high-volatility slots might be excluded, or table games might contribute only a small percentage to the wagering. Reading these stipulations carefully prevents unexpected issues when you decide to cash out.
| Bonus Type | Typical Wagering Requirement | Game Contributions | Max Bet Rule |
|---|---|---|---|
| Welcome Bonus | 25x-40x (Bonus + Deposit) | Slots: 100%, Table Games: 10-20%, Live Casino: 5-10% | $5 per spin/bet |
| Reload Bonus | 20x-35x (Bonus Amount) | Slots: 100%, Other Games: Varies | $5-$10 per spin/bet |
| Free Spins | 30x-50x (Winnings from Spins) | Specific slot games | N/A (usually applied to winnings) |
